AWS Transit Gateway allows the connection of multiple VPCs and on-premises networks through a single gateway, enabling centralized management and simplifying network architecture. It supports both inter-VPC and VPC-to-on-premises connectivity.
AWS Direct Connect is a dedicated network connection that provides a private connection to AWS, but it does not inherently connect multiple VPCs; rather, it connects on-premises networks to AWS services. It can be used in conjunction with Transit Gateway but does not meet the requirement by itself.
VPC peering enables direct communication between two VPCs, but it does not support connecting multiple VPCs or on-premises networks through a single connection. Each peering relationship is one-to-one, requiring multiple connections for multiple VPCs.
AWS Client VPN provides a secure connection for individual clients to access AWS resources but does not connect multiple VPCs or on-premises networks through a single connection. It is more suited for remote access rather than interconnecting networks.
